Should you play it?

GRIP is a high octane, hardcore combat racer, packing ferocious speed and armed to the teeth with heavy weapons. Inspired by games like Rollcage, Wipeout, Motorstorm and Star Wars Podracer, it's like nothing you've ever played before.

What works
  • Fast-paced and thrilling gameplay
  • Vehicle customization options
  • Varied and creative track designs
  • Engaging multiplayer and splitscreen modes
  • Nostalgic homage to rollcage with modern polish
Things to keep in mind
  • Steep learning curve and high difficulty
  • Sometimes unforgiving physics and crashes
  • Limited online playerbase
  • Minimal narrative or story depth
  • Some ui and progression system issues
